The fiducial cross sections for ZZ → ℓ⁺ℓ⁻ℓ′⁻ℓ′⁺ and ZZ→ ℓ⁻ℓ⁺νν̅ are measured in selected phase-space regions. The total cross section for ZZ events produced with both Z bosons in the mass range 66 to 116 GeV is measured from the combination of the two channels to be 7.3 ± 0.4(stat) ± 0.3(syst) _{-0.1}^{-0.2} (lumi) pb, which is consistent with the Standard Model prediction of 6. 6_{−0.6}^{+ 0.7} pb. The differential cross sections in bins of various kinematic variables are presented.
